Australian's adult are winners

Looking at data from the USA, Germany, the UK and Australia, a recent review in the ADJ 2009 reported that Australian adults oral health was among the best.

In a past OECD 2000 health study Australia ranked below Germany, UK and USA. In the most recent analysis Australia ranked 1st or 2nd in 9 oral health and oral health behavior indicators. As an explanation for the change in finding it was reported that tooth loss had declined precipitously in Australia over the last 10 years.
